Subject:

LaSalle County Station Unit 1 Inservice Inspection Program NRC Docket No. 50-373 Reference (a): LaSalle County Station Unit 1 Inservice Inspection Program Revision 1 dated June 3, 1982

Dear Sir:

Enclosed is Addenda A to the LaSalle Unit 1 Inservice Inspection (ISI) program. This addenda corrects inadequacies found in the existing i program (reference (a)). The necessity for this change and detailed i discussion of each aspect is included in the attachment. l The revisions provided in the addenda improve the quality of the LaSalle Unit 1 ISI program. The addenda will be implemented prior to the Unit 1, second refueling outage which is currently scheduled to start in March 1988.

Commonwealth Edison is notifying the State of Illinois of our request for this change to the ISI program by transmitting'a copy of this letter and attachment to the designated state official.

In accordance with 10 CFR 170 a fee remittance in the amount of.

$150.00 is enclosed.

ATTACHMENT Description of Addendum A of the LaSalle Unit 1 Inservice Inspection Program i

l l

The addenda is necessary as the existing Inservice Inspection l program (Rev. 1, dated June 3, 1982), is lacking in the following areas: j i

the program does not include all high stress welds, as required by ASME Section XI. A meticulous review of the piping stress pattern, by architect engineers Sargent & Lundy, has shown the original high stress weld group to be inaccurate;

-- one ASME Class 1 dissimilar metal weld was inadvertently placed in Examination Category B-J. This addenda transfers the weld to the I Category B-F Program in accordance with ASME Section XI; the program does not concentrate inspections on those areas where a relatively high probability of pressure boundary degradation exists. For example, no effort was made to bias the inspection sample towards the examination of stainless steel or inconel welds which have shown a susceptibility to stress corrosion cracking; the program lists many welds for inspection which are in a very high radiation area or which are partially or fully inaccessible for inspection. ASME Section XI permits some flexibility when determining the weld inspection group to allow for ease of inspectability and to help maintain radiation dosage as low as possible; the program contained inappropriate welds in the Augmented Inspection Type 1A Category. Systems not considered to be in high energy line break exclusion regions were listed as such in the Type 1A Category.

This revision affects the weld inspection scope for the ASME Section XI Examination Category B-F Program, the Category B-J Program, and the Category C-F Program. These are, respectively, ' Class 1 Pressure Retaining Dissimilar Metal Welds', ' Class 1 Pressure Retaining Welds in Piping', and ' class 2 Pressure Reta*.ning Welds in Piping'. The revision also affects the weld population of Augmented Inspection Type 1A, 'High Energy Welds'.

. Page 2 of 5 LaSalle Unit 1 is required to follow the 1980 Edition including the Winter 1980 Addenda of ASME Section XI. This Code contains specific requirements for program weld selection in the footnotes of Tables IVB-2500-1 for Class 1 components, and IWC-2500-1 for Class 2 components.

These footnotes are transcribed below.

The requirements for Examination Category B-F are as follows; (1) Examinations are required on each safe end weld in each loop and connecting branches of the reactor coolant system.

(2) For the reactor vessel nozzle safe ends, the examinations may be performed coincident with the vessel nozzle examinations required by Examination Category B-D.

(3) Includes dissimilar metal welds between combinations of:

(a) carbon or low alloy steels to high alloy steels; (b) carbon or low alloy steels to low nickel alloys; (c) high alloy steels to high nickel alloys.

One weld which meets the inclusion criteria of (3)(a) above was discovered, and this addenda adds that weld to the 10-year inspection program under Examination Category B-F. This weld was included as a Category B-J weld in the ISI Program, Rev. 1. A summary listing of those welds which require inspection due to the stipulations of Examination Category B-F is enclosed as a part of the addenda. This list should be incorporated into the LaSalle Unit 1 Inservice Inspection Program under Tab

  1. 11.

Examination Category B-J requires that; (1) Examinations shall include the following:

(a) All terminal ends in each pipe or branch run connected to vessels; (b) All terminal ends and joints in each pipe or branch run connected to other components where the stress levels exceed the following limits under loads associated with specific seismic events and operational conditions:

(1) primary plus secondary stress intensity range of 2.4Sm for ferritic steel and austenitic steel; l l

(2) cumulative usage factor 'U' of 0.4.

(c) All dissimilar metal welds between combinations of:

(1) carbon or low alloy steels to high alloy steels; 3944K i

Pege 3 of 5 (2) carbon or low alloy steel to high nickel alloys; (3) high alloy steels to high nickel alloys.

(d) Additional pipe welds so that the total number of circumferential butt welds (or branch connection or socket welds) selected for examination equals 25% of the circumferential butt welds (or branch connection or socket welds) in the reactor coolant piping system. This total does not include welds excluded by IWB-1220. These additional welds may be located in one loop (one loop is currently defined for both PWR and BWR plants in the 1980 Edition).

(2) The initially selected welds shall be re-examined during each inspection interval.

(3) Includes essentially 100% of weld length.

(4) The examination includes at least a pipe diameter, but not more than 12 in., of each longitudinal weld intersecting the circumferential welds required to be examined by Examination Categories B-F and B-J.

(5) For welds in carbon or low alloy steels, only those welds showing reportable preservice transverse indications need be inspected for transverse reflectors.

Inspections addressed by Note (1)(a) and Note (1)(c) above were already required by Examination Category B-P, and are included under the Category B-F program List.

Note (1)(b) above requires the inspection of all Class 1 high stress welds. All high stress welds are included in the attached Category B-J inspection program revision and are indicated as such in the ' Notes' column.

Note (1)(d) requires the total number of Class 1 circumferential butt welds inspected to be equal to 25% of the total number of non-exempt class 1 circumferential butt welds. These additional welds have been added to the Category B-J Inspection Program to bring the mir.imum number of welds inspected to be at least equal to the required percentage. Because these additional welds are required as a certain size group, not as a specific weld sample, LaSalle reserves the right to substitute welds within that group when inspection difficulties are encountered, as long as all ASME Section XI requirements are satisfied. Welds will only be substituted during the first inspection interval so that Note (2) above is not violated. All weld substitutions will be reported in the Inservice Inspection Summary Report subsequent to the inspection where the substitution occurred.

Note (3) above is adhered to with the exception that some welds are addressed by a previously approved relief request which describes an alternate examination. It this is the case, the relief request will be referenced on the Category B-J program list. The Inservice Inspection Program, Rev. 1, contains all relief requests in their entirety.

The requirements for Examination Category C-F are as follows:

(1) The welds selected for examination shall include:

(a) all welds at locations where the stresses under the loadings result from normal and upset plant conditions as calculated by the sum of equations (9) and (10) in NC-3652 exceed 0.8(1.2Sh+Sa);

(b) all welds at terminal ends (see (e) below) of piping or branch runs; (c) all dissimilar metal welds; (d) additional welds, at structural discontinuities (see (f) below), such that the total number of welds selected for examination includes the following percentages of circumferential piping welds; ,

For boiling water reactors:

l (1) none of the welds exempted by IWC-1220, 1

(2) none of the welds in residual heat removal and emergency core cooling systems (see (g) below), ,

(3) 50% of the main steam system welds, (4') 25% of the welds in all other systems.

(e) terminal ends are the extremities of piping runs that connect to structures, components (such as vessels, pumps, valves), or pipe anchors, each of which act as rigid restraints or provide at least two degrees of l restraint to piping thermal expansion; l (f) structural discontinuities include pipe weld joints to

' vessel nozzles, valve bodies, pump casings, pipe fittings (such as elbows, tees, reducers, flanges, etc. conforming to ANSI B16.9), and pipe branch connections and fittings.

(g) examination requirements are under development.

(2) The welds initially selected for examination shall be  ;

re-examined over the service lifetime of the piping component. l (3) For welds in carbon or low alloy steels, only those welds showing reportable preservice transverse indications need to l

be examined for transverse reflectors.

  • " Page 5 of 5 Note (1)(a) above does not apply as no high stress welds exist on the Class 2 piping.

All terminal ends and dissimilar metal welds have been included in the Category C-F Program as required by Notes (1)(b) and (1)(c) above.

These welds are identified in the notes column of the Category C-F Program a List.

Note (1)(d) was adhered to in all cases except that Note (1)(d)(2) was not used. A total of 25% of the welds in RHR and the ECCS systems were selected for examination and included in the Category C-F Program.

A summary listing of the welds in the 10-year Category C-F Program l are included with this letter. This list should be incorporated into the i Inservice Inspection Program, Rev. 1, under Tab #31. More information on these welds (such as pipe size, calibration std., etc.) can also be found i under Tab #31.

As was done for the Examination Category B-J Program, LaSalle reserves the right to revise the specific weld sample to meet ASME Section XI requirements. Most of the welds in this category are optional as long as the minimum percentage requirements are maintained. Again, any weld substitutions resulting from inspection difficulties will be reported in the subsequent ISI Summary Report. Substitutions will only be permitted during the first inspection interval.

Augmented Inspection Type 1A requires the testing of all circumferential butt welds (and the associated seam welds) on those lines considered to be in high energy line break exclusion regions. The list of welds presented in the ISI Program, Rev. 1, contained portions of systems which are not considered to be in these regions. This addenda revises the Augmented Inspection Type 1A Program to delete those welds not in high l energy line break exclusion regions. The revised program is included and should be incorporated into the ISI Program, Rev. 1, Tab #36.

The ISI Program changes made by this addenda are in full accordance with ASME Section XI and in no way violate the LaSalle Station Technical Specifications or the LaSalle Updated Final Safety Analysis Report. These changes have been approved by a formal on site review in accordance with station procedures.

LaSalle plans to implement this addenda prior to the Unit 1 2nd Refueling Outage which is currently scheduled to start in March, 1988.
